Transaction

02a3b7b210262d2c8c70ada12c34e7741cfe678b7b99356bbb78035c24cefacc

Summary

In Block397698
TimeSat, 14 Oct 2023 10:15:30 UTC
Total Input2253.61667152 Nebula
Total Output2287.61667152 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
576170 Confirmations2287.61667152 Nebula
Raw Transaction